A college senior who took the Graduate Record Examination exam scored 630 on the Verbal Reasoning section and 600 on the Quantitative Reasoning section. The mean score for Verbal Reasoning section was 455 with a standard deviation of 108, and the mean score for the Quantitative Reasoning was 449 with a standard deviation of 147. Suppose that both distributions are nearly normal. Round calculated answers to 4 decimal places unless directed otherwise.

1.What is her percentile score on the Verbal Reasoning section? Round to nearest whole number.

2. What is her percentile score on the Quantitative Reasoning section? Round to nearest whole number.

3. What percent of the test takers did better than she did on the Verbal Reasoning section?  %

4. What percent of the test takers did better than she did on the Quantitative Reasoning section?  %

5. What is the score of a student who scored in the 65th65th percentile on the Quantitative Reasoning section? Round to the nearest integer.

6. What is the score of a student who scored worse than 41% of the test takers in the Verbal Reasoning section? Round to the nearest integer.
